The sun shone bright over the rolling plastic grass of the carnival golf. Sugar smiled at Scoops as he handed her a matching club and golf ball for the day. She looked across the courses, seeing many different chicoons tackling the different challenges in all sorts of unique says. Sugar took a moment to stretch her arms and legs, she didn't want to pull anything when she swung! After she was all stretched and satisfied she got ready to start with the first hole. This was the most straightforward so it was a good warmup, but since it was the most basic not too many chicoons were gathered around and Sugar was able to step right up and complete it quickly.
She skipped across to the next one, humming a tune along with her companion, and made it to the course with the big orange chicoon statue. "My nemesis" she thought, as it had repeatedly caused her trouble. Her companion Mulberry hyped her up, gave her a tiny shoulder massage and Sugar was ready to try it once more. Although not perfect, she did better than she'd done before, so she would be satisfied with that for now! Onto the next!
Next was the legendary ring of fire! Sugar chuckled at the dramatic sight, but all things considered, it wasn't the most difficult course of them all. She took some care to not singe her golf ball in the fire, but it made it into the hole easy enough.
What was next? Another standard type of course except... Scoops? Why was he always trying to nap right on top of this course? Isn't he supposed to be in charge here? Is the fake grass softer here? Sugar didn't know, but with some budging and some ice-cream bribery she was finally able to get Scoops to move just long enough for her to make the shot for this course.
The next hole though... was another ordeal. It was a huge pile of ice cream several feet tall and wide. Sugar shook her head at the ridiculous sight, but she called out to the entire golf course and chicoons of all shapes and sizes showed up to help "clean up" the ice cream. It was a bit gross... but hey, it's hot and sunny who can really say no to ice cream? Once that was cleared up the next two holes were straightforward, and she happily completed them (though her golf ball did end up a bit sticky...)
Lastly, what Sugar had to admit was her favorite, the course with the tiny bridge and adorable windmill. The course was a bit more difficult than some of the others with it's twists and turns, trying to make it over the bridge, and avoid the blades of the windmill. But it was such a cute set that Sugar didn't mind spending a bit more time there.
After all was done, Sugar had a great time playing golf at the carnival! (496)

Prompt: Everett anxiously tugged at their white polo shirt that they spent an hour ironing this morning. They looked down at their gold watch again. This particular watch was only worn for special occasions. Only a minute and forty seconds had passed from the last time they glanced at the watch. Their ears lowered slightly as they realized how badly they had misinterpreted this booth. When seeing the advertisement for Scoop’s Carnival Golf prior to the actual carnival, Everett incorrectly assumed that it would be actual golf — not miniature golf. They were so excited to play that they bought the white polo that now cling to their sweaty body from a department store. Why did they assume that this booth would be like professional golf? This was a carnival, of course.

Everett also vastly underestimated the amount of players. It seemed like practically every Chicoon never played golf before. Everett overheard Chicoons discussing how to play golf, and how to properly hold the ‘golf racquet’ or ‘golf bat’’. Forty minutes into their arrival, they were still waiting for their chance to play the first course.

Finally, after what seemed like an eternity, Everett bounded up to Scoop. They quickly mumbled an apology for their attire. “I think I am a little overdressed.” Kneeling down in the grass, Everett studied every twist and then of the course in front of them. After a few seconds, they stood up and dusted off their legs. “I got this.” They said to themselves, blushing when they realized that Scoop could hear them.

Everett not only felt excited due to the fact that they could rarely find anybody to play golf with, but also because they knew they were going to show the other Chicoons how golf was really played. Everett swung the club, keeping the club over their shoulder even after the club made contact with the ball. They felt like a big man on the course — a true professional. However, to Everett’s disappointment horror, the golf ball was not even close to the hole. Their heart sunk. What were the other Chicoons thinking? Were the Chicoons behind them snickering? Everett continued to play the course, since they were certainly not a quitter, but could not help but feel like crying when they ended up receiving a four.

Everett began to walk away, but quickly found that somebody’s tail was wrapping around their own tail. “You looked great out there! Do you think you can teach me?” Wonka said. Everett quickly blinked away the tears they were about to fall. Clearing their voice, they honked. “I would be happy to.”

Everett had some highs and lows while playing the other courses; however, they were genuinely able to have fun and let loose. Maybe miniature golf was not so inferior after all.
